Breaking the Cycle Between Food Production and Environmental Decline
URBANA, Illinois, US, May 6 (IPS) – A newly published review in Nature Reviews Earth & Environment has revealed disturbing statistics on the growing environmental threats posed by global food production. The global food system, designed to feed and nourish humanity, is now a major contributor to climate change via greenhouse gas emissions, and the largest driver of freshwater depletion, biodiversity loss, and nutrient pollution.
